The group toured with Automatic Loveletter in July 2008,in the fall they toured with Family Force Five and The Maine, then embarked on their first headlining tour (entitled "There Came a Tour") with There For Tomorrow, In:Aviate, and The Lives of Famous Men. The band is currently a four-piece and working on new material.
In February of 2009, they premiered their music video for "Days End" on AbsolutePunk.net -- the video, filmed in mid-2008, includes their former guitarist and then was featured on the Summer Bailout tour with Emery, Maylene and the sons of disaster, Closure in Moscow and Secret & Whisper then finished out the year on the Vans Warped Tour.
During July & August of this year they toured alongside Dance Gavin Dance, Silverstein, and Emery on the Scream it Like You Mean It Tour. Ivoryline is currently on Creation Fest the Tour 2010 with Thousand Foot Krutch and Disciple.
The newest album is entitled "Vessels" and was released July 27th.

The lyrics to Ivoryline's song "With The Daylight" speak to the experience of pain and heartache, and the process of finding peace and healing amidst it. The first verse acknowledges the reality of facing pain in the present moment, but encourages the listener to release their buried grief in order to find healing. The second verse emphasizes the importance of letting go and allowing grace and love to take hold in one's heart, without having to grasp for it. The chorus repeats the idea that the peace being sought after is heavy, but that it will come with the breaking of the day.
The bridge shifts to a larger perspective, acknowledging that restoration is happening even though it may not be fully understood. The song brings in spiritual themes, referring to God as "the one who calls himself 'I am'", and describing darkness succumbing to light all over the world. The final moments of the song return to the personal perspective of the listener, with their heart feeling the weight of the grief but also breaking out with the daylight - perhaps a metaphor for newfound hope and optimism.
Overall, the lyrics of "With The Daylight" capture the experience of moving through pain and darkness towards healing and peace, with the help of grace, love, and a larger spiritual context.
